“Snow’s dad, sorry, I have something to take care of tomorrow morning, so I won’t be able to make it to the park. Are you free the day after tomorrow? Maybe we can let the little ones meet then.”

The smile faded instantly from Gordon’s face, replaced by a look of cold detachment.

Why the day after tomorrow?

Where is Caitlin going tomorrow?

He quickly typed a reply: “The day after tomorrow works for me. See you then.”

“Great,” Caitlin answered.

That night, Gordon had a nightmare.

He jolted awake in the middle of the night, drenched in sweat, heart pounding uncontrollably.

Wiping his forehead, he reached for his phone on the nightstand and opened up a search engine. He typed in:

“What does it mean to dream about a normal female friend being with another man?”

He scrolled through the responses.

“It just means you’ve been thinking about her a lot, bro. Are you sure you don’t have a crush on that girl?”

“Nothing special. Maybe those two really do have chemistry.”

“Congrats, man. Your ‘ordinary female friend’ might be getting a boyfriend soon.”

Gordon frowned, his brows knitting together.

With Farrell? Would Caitlin really go for someone like that?

Forget it. Not my business anyway.

He locked his phone and rolled over, determined to go back to sleep.

Sixty seconds later, Gordon sat up again, grabbed his phone, and went back to scrolling through the search results.

After a while, his frown finally eased. He even tipped one of the replies a hundred dollars.

The reply read: “Don’t overthink it. Dreams always mean the opposite.”

The next morning, Gordon finished breakfast and got ready for work.

Just as he reached the garage, someone stepped in his way.

“Gordon.”

He paused.
